Supply Chain Analyst
- Salary: € 5.000 - € 6.000
- Location: Veldhoven
Job Mission
Your mission is to design and build scalable data and automation solutions that transform operational and tactical supply chain processes into reliable, data-driven workflows. Using languages such as Python, Java, or other relevant technologies, you will develop pipelines, models, and tools that enable near touchless execution, improving speed, accuracy, and resilience across the supply chain.
Data Engineering, Automation & Optimization
- Design, build, and maintain data pipelines and applications that automate operational activities and enhance tactical decision models.
- Develop data models and datasets that improve planning accuracy and supply chain visibility.
- Define and maintain a data & automation roadmap aligned with business and stakeholder needs.
- Identify and implement continuous improvement opportunities using analytics, automation, and best practices.
- Ensure data quality, reliability, and performance across systems.
Operational Responsibilities
- Collaborate within a team of data engineers and analysts to deliver reliable, production-ready solutions.
- Monitor, troubleshoot, and resolve issues in data pipelines and automation workflows.
- Maintain and continuously improve the data and application landscape.
- Support stakeholders with insights and data products for operational and tactical decision-making.
Education
- A relevant Master’s degree (e.g., Industrial Engineering, Data Science, Operations Research, Supply Chain, Econometrics, Applied Mathematics) or
- A Bachelor’s degree combined with relevant experience and a strong analytical mindset.
Experience
- Proven experience in programming (e.g., Python, Java, SQL, or other modern languages).
- Strong skills in data analysis, data modeling, and building data pipelines.
- 2–5 years of relevant experience in Supply Chain, Operations, Data Engineering, Analytics, or a related field.
- Experience with ERP systems (e.g., SAP) and integrating business data is a strong plus.
- Familiarity with databases, cloud platforms, or big data tools is an advantage.
